A Coastal Sentinel:
The Daman Sea Fort, also known as the Fort of St. Jerome, has stood as a formidable coastal sentinel for centuries. Its location on the western coast of India provided a vantage point for monitoring maritime activities and defending against invasions.
Architectural Marvel:
The fort's architectural design reflects a fusion of Portuguese and Indian influences. Its robust structure, made of stone and laterite, showcases intricate craftsmanship and a blend of European and local architectural elements.
Historical Significance:
Built during the 16th century, the Daman Sea Fort holds immense historical significance. It served as a stronghold for the Portuguese, who established their presence in the region and controlled trade routes along the Arabian Sea.
The Portuguese Legacy:
Under Portuguese rule, the fort became a hub of activity, serving as a military base, administrative center, and trading post. It played a crucial role in the expansion of Portuguese influence in the Indian Ocean and the establishment of their colonial empire.
